Have you been thinking about adopting an adventure partner but don’t want all the work of a puppy? Ashton may be just what you are looking for. At 55 pounds and about 1-1/2 years old, Ashton is the perfect size and age to go with you on whatever adventures you have planned. Hiking (check). Leash walks (check). Off-leash and recall (training in progress and doing great!) Chasing chickens/ducks (check)…ummm….well probably best if you don’t plan that activity. He likes this a little bit too much… Ashton’s idea of a good play date is meeting up with a few trusted dog friends. He’s not a social butterfly, and a crowded off-leash dog park isn’t his idea of a good time. He is happier being around his people than staying at home by himself in a crate. If you have a job that would let you bring him along sometimes, that would make his day. Ashton came to Path of Hope last summer, all the way from Amarillo, Texas. Since then, he has been hanging out with his foster family and learning all the important things about being a family dog. He has basic obedience training, leash walking, potty training, and crate training. He is a good guard dog and an amazing construction site supervisor. In his spare time he uses every charming dog tactic to snuggle his way into your bed (hey, it doesn’t hurt to ask, right?). He is a smart boy that just wants to please his people. With this combination, you can teach him anything. He’s enjoyed his time with his foster family, but he is so ready to find his forever family. Is that family you?
